This homemade stromboli features a soft, buttery yeast dough rolled out and filled with a creamy ricotta and parmesan mixture, layers of melted mozzarella, and savory pepperoni. Baked until golden brown and brushed with melted butter, it makes for a hearty and satisfying main course. Perfect for family dinners or entertaining, this recipe delivers the authentic taste of a classic Italian deli favorite.

Directions
-
Sesame seeds Preheat oven to 200 degrees for 15 minutes and turn off.
-
Combine yeast, sugar and warm water in a small mixing bowl.
-
Set aside for 5 minutes until foamy.
-
In the workbowl of a food processor, add flour, butter pieces and salt.
-
Process for 20 seconds.
-
Add ice water to yeast.
-
With the processor running,
-
add yeast-water mixture gradually, until all of the moisture is absorbed and the dough leaves the side of the bowl.
-
Process for an additional 60 seconds.
-
Transfer dough from the workbowl to a large greased mixing bowl.
-
Cover with a kitchen towel and place in warm off oven.
-
Allow to rise until doubled, approximately 1 1/2 hours.
-
Combine the ricotta and Parmesan.
-
Punch down the risen dough and transfer to a floured rolling surface.
-
With quick, hard strokes, roll dough into a large rectangle, approximately 1/2 inch thick.
-
Layer one- half of the mozzarella cheese evenly down the center leaving approximately three inches of exposed dough on either side.
-
Top with the ricotta mixture and pepperoni, and the remaining mozzarella.
-
Overlap the exposed dough over the cheese mixture and pinch well on all sides to seal.
-
Transfer to a large cookie sheet, seam side up.
-
Cover with a kitchen towel and return to the warmed oven.
-
Allow to rise until doubled, approximately 45 minutes.
-
Brush loaf with melted butter and sprinkle with sesame seeds.
-
Bake at 350 degrees for 35 to 40 minutes or until loaf is well browned and hollow sounding when thumped.
